Responsibilities:

  • Develop creative and level-appropriate programs and pathways for swimmers who are learning to swim and developing their techniques.
  • Lead and advocate for our Elementary Squads progress, in collaboration with the Head of Competitive Swimming
  • Be a champion for those who prefer to swim recreationally rather than competitively
  • Lead and manage the Eagle Club Swim School in collaboration with the Swim School Manager.
  • Plan and manage fun, safe indoor dry-land activities in case of inclement weather
  • Set up and run swimmers evaluation sessions (face-to-face or virtual) to ensure appropriate team placement
  • Manage related day-to-day communications with coaches, parents, and other stakeholders
  • Train and lead coaches who are implementing your programs
  • Actively participate in EAA or Swim Program team meetings
  • Assist in maintaining Eagle Club Swimming records and website content
  • Actively seek and advocate for additional opportunities for level-appropriate meets and competitions
  • Work closely with the Singapore American School Aquatics Coordinator and senior coaching staff to plan and manage swimmers pathways, scheduling, logistics, and staffing
  • Work closely with the Eagle Activities and Athletics Office for community-wide communications and swimmer registrations
  • Support fellow coaching team members to achieve their professional best and to achieve a positive and inclusive working environment
  • Set up and manage age-appropriate holiday Swim Camps when required

Required Coaching Skills and Experience:

  • 5+ years of full-time swim coaching experience or swim teaching equivalent
  • ASCA level 3 or NROC level 2 and technical swimming level 2 or equivalent
  • Be able to coach different level/age team swimmers
  • Be able to train and develop adult coaches
  • Current knowledge in technique development and stroke correction
  • Qualified in First Aid (certification training available for the right candidate)

Preferred Skills/Knowledge/Experience:

  • Proficient with Google Suite (Docs, Sheets, Slides, Forms)
  • Familiar with CHQ or SchoolsBuddy (Training will be provided)
  • Proficient with Hytek Meet/Team Manager software
  • Experienced with Colorado Gen7 Timing systems (or similar)
  • Have spoken and written English at a professional level
